Classification of the substance or mixture Classification according to Regulation (EC) No. 1272/2008 [CLP] Sensitisation Skin, Category 1 H317 Carcinogenicity, Category 2 H351 Specific target organ toxicity Repeated exposure, Category 1 H372 Full text of H statements : see section 16 2.2. Label elements Labelling according to Regulation (EC) No. 1272/2008 [CLP] Extra labelling to displayextra classification(s) to display Hazard pictograms (CLP) : Signal word (CLP) Hazardous ingredients Hazard statements (CLP) Precautionary statements (CLP) : Danger GHS07 : nickel, cobalt GHS08 : H317 - May cause an allergic skin reaction H351 - Suspected of causing cancer (if inhaled) H372 - Causes damage to organs through prolonged or repeated exposure : P201 - Obtain special instructions before use P202 - Do not handle until all safety precautions have been read and understood P260 - Do not breathe dust, fume P264 - Wash hands thoroughly after handling P270 - Do not eat, drink or smoke when using this product P272 - Contaminated work clothing should not be allowed out of the workplace 11/25/2015 EN (English) 1/7

Mixture Name Product identifier % Classification according to Regulation (EC) No. 1272/2008 [CLP] nickel (CAS No) 7440-02-0 (EC no) 231-111-4 (EC index no) 028-002-00-7 red phosphorus (CAS No) 7723-14-0 (EC no) 231-768-7 (EC index no) 015-002-00-7 cobalt (CAS No) 7440-48-4 (EC no) 231-158-0 (EC index no) 027-001-00-9 Full text of H-statements: see section 16 >= 40 Carc. 2, H351 STOT RE 1, H372 Skin Sens. 1, H317 < 20 Flam. Sol. 1, H228 Aquatic Chronic 3, H412 0.1-1 Resp. Sens. 1, H334 Skin Sens. 1, H317 Aquatic Chronic 4, H413 SECTION 4: First aid measures 4.1. Toxicity Ecology - general Ecology - water Contact dermatitis may result from direct exposure to the skin. : May cause an allergic skin reaction. Long-term exposure to brazing fume, gasses, or dust may contribute to pulmonary irritation or pneumoconiosis. : Suspected of causing cancer (if inhaled). : Causes damage to organs through prolonged or repeated exposure. : May cause cancer. : 2B : Likely routes of exposure: inhalation. : The product is not considered harmful to aquatic organisms or to cause long-term adverse effects in the environment. : The product does not have any known adverse effect on the tested aquatic organisms. 12.2.
